public class UnwrappingSelectionProvider
extends java.lang.Object
Modifier and Type | Field and Description |
---|---|
protected java.util.List<ISelectionChangedListener> |
listeners |
protected ISelection |
selection |
protected ISelectionChangedListener |
selectionChangedListener |
Constructor and Description |
---|
UnwrappingSelectionProvider(ISelectionProvider selectionProvider) |
Modifier and Type | Method and Description |
---|---|
void |
addSelectionChangedListener(ISelectionChangedListener listener) |
protected void |
fireSelectionChanged() |
ISelection |
getSelection() |
void |
removeSelectionChangedListener(ISelectionChangedListener listener) |
void |
setSelection(ISelection selection) |
protected java.lang.Object |
unwrap(java.lang.Object object) |
protected ISelection selection
protected java.util.List<ISelectionChangedListener> listeners
protected ISelectionChangedListener selectionChangedListener
public UnwrappingSelectionProvider(ISelectionProvider selectionProvider)
public void addSelectionChangedListener(ISelectionChangedListener listener)
public ISelection getSelection()
public void removeSelectionChangedListener(ISelectionChangedListener listener)
public void setSelection(ISelection selection)
protected java.lang.Object unwrap(java.lang.Object object)
protected void fireSelectionChanged()